Ozone System Failure
Ozone generator is not operating; no ozone bubbles visible at ozone injector
Advertisements
Possible Causes
Failed ozone generator module, Clogged ozone injector or check valve, Disconnected ozone tubing, Ozone output disabled in control settings
How to Fix / Troubleshooting
Safety: Turn OFF power at the GFCI breaker before servicing the ozone system.
- Check settings: Some Bullfrog systems allow ozone to be enabled/disabled in the control menu. Ensure ozone is enabled.
- Inspect tubing: Locate the ozone generator and follow the silicone tubing to the injector. Ensure tubing is connected at both ends and not kinked.
- Check check valve: Inspect the ozone check valve for blockage or failure. Replace if it allows water to backflow into the ozone generator.
- Observe operation: During a filtration cycle, look for fine bubbles at the ozone injection point. If none are present and tubing is intact, the ozone generator may have failed and should be replaced with a Bullfrog-compatible unit.
